GIF压缩免费无损工具和方法,gif无损压缩软件推荐
GIF压缩免费无损工具和方法,gif无损压缩软件推荐在社交媒体、网站设计或日常办公中,GIF动图的广泛应用使得压缩需求日益增长。尽管如此,许多用户担心压缩会降低画质或产生额外费用。我们这篇文章将详细介绍12种免费且无损的GIF压缩解决方案
GIF压缩免费无损工具和方法,gif无损压缩软件推荐
在社交媒体、网站设计或日常办公中,GIF动图的广泛应用使得压缩需求日益增长。尽管如此,许多用户担心压缩会降低画质或产生额外费用。我们这篇文章将详细介绍12种免费且无损的GIF压缩解决方案,涵盖在线工具、软件应用及技术原理,帮助您在保证画质的前提下高效减小文件体积。主要内容包括:无损压缩原理说明;在线工具推荐(3款);桌面软件推荐(4款);Photoshop高级技巧;命令行工具方案;手机APP解决方案;7. 常见问题解答。
一、无损压缩原理说明
真正的无损压缩通过优化GIF的调色板(Color Table)和帧差异(Frame Delta)实现:
- 调色板优化:将256色限制缩减至实际使用的颜色数,例如仅含50色的动图可减少78%调色板空间
- 帧差异化存储:仅记录相邻帧的变化区域(如只有20%像素变动时,可节省80%帧数据)
- LZW算法优化:改进编码字典的生成方式,使相同图案复用率提升30%-50%
注意:部分工具宣称的"无损"可能包含有损的尺寸裁剪,建议压缩前后用专业工具(如GIFsicle)比对像素数据。
二、在线工具推荐(免安装)
1. Ezgif.com
▸ 特点:提供帧级精度优化,可手动删除冗余帧
▸ 压缩率:通常可达40%-70%
▸ 优势:保留原始调色板,支持批量处理
2. TinyPNG GIF版
▸ 特点:智能量化算法(WebP转换技术)
▸ 压缩率:50%-80%且肉眼无差别
▸ 限制:单文件≤5MB(免费版)
3. GIFCompressor.com
▸ 特点:三重压缩模式(保守/均衡/激进)
▸ 独家技术:动态区域识别,非变化背景仅存储1次
三、专业软件方案
软件名称 | 支持系统 | 核心功能 | 开源 |
---|---|---|---|
GIMP+插件 | Win/macOS/Linux | 逐帧编辑与高级量化 | ✓ |
GIFsicle | 命令行跨平台 | 业界标准无损压缩 | ✓ |
FFmpeg | 全平台 | 视频转GIF时直接优化 | ✓ |
ScreenToGIF | Windows | 录屏后自动优化 | ✓ |
★ 专家建议:GIFsicle通过命令 gifsicle -O3 --lossy=80 input.gif -o output.gif
可实现最佳压缩比。
四、Photoshop专业技巧
即使使用PS也能实现无损压缩:
- 文件→导出→存储为Web所用格式(旧版)
- 关键设置:
- 颜色:64色以下(视内容调整)
- 勾选"交错"和"透明度优化"
- 取消勾选"抖动"(避免噪点)
- 比较原图与优化图,确保关键帧无劣化
五、开发者解决方案
适用于批量处理的代码方案:
// Node.js示例(需安装gifencoder)
const GIFEncoder = require('gifencoder');
encoder.setQuality(80); // 无损范围80-100
encoder.setRepeat(0); // 0=无限循环
encoder.setDelay(100); // 帧间隔(ms)
Python推荐使用Pillow库的Image.seek()
方法进行帧分析优化。
六、手机端处理APP
安卓/iOS通用推荐:
- GIF Brewery 3(iOS付费但可试用):支持关键帧抽取
- ImgPlay(跨平台):智能识别静态背景
- GIF Maker(安卓免费):内置压缩强度调节
七、常见问题解答
为什么有些GIF压缩后仍有色差?
可能使用了有损算法,建议检查工具是否关闭"抖动(Dither)"选项,并确认处理前后调色板数量一致。
专业摄影GIF如何保持高质量?
推荐先用FFmpeg转换为MP4视频(H.265编码),再用-vf "fps=10,scale=720:-1"
参数生成GIF,比直接处理节省60%空间。
法律注意事项
部分在线工具会保留上传文件24小时,敏感内容建议使用本地软件处理。
相关文章